I love my herd "stalls". Every morning, all horses are together in one stall. I have 2 15x30 stalls that can be subdivided if necessary. This allows shelter while maintaining the herd dynamics.

Mane pulls is a gentle and effective myofascial release technique that anyone can perform successfully. Gather the mane at the base with one or two handfulls. Gently and slowly pull upwards. Hold for a few minutes. Shift the direction of pull to the right and towards the left. This simple decompression of the fascia can improve skin mobility and functional range of motion.

Treating Without Pain...that's the key!

Being aggressive makes no sense. The more pain you create, and the more aggressive you are, the more the body will protect itself. Stiffness, tightness, weakness and swelling are all protective responses. You can get people to have full ROM in 1/2 the time if you start with the skin layer… not the muscle and joint.

Difference between beginner camp and intermediate camp.

Beginner camp is for students ages 7-18 years old who would love to learn the beginning stages of horse riding and horsemanship. This day will be packed full of everyday horse husbandry, from learning about the equipment we use to learning the feel of riding. Our biggest goal is safety, so everything we do is based on that and on the regulations of the Certified Horsemanship Association. This group will mainly focus on balance, control, and the walk and trot. We will be offering both English and Western style tack.

Intermediate day camp is for students ages 7-18 who are already jumping and/or can walk, trot, and canter. These students will have their skills challenged by obstacles/courses, asking horses for body movements (on the ground and under saddle). Horse husbandry is a huge part of horses; this group will get more in-depth with that, often in farm life and outdoor situations or seasonal scenarios.
